2 dead in murder-suicide in Cochise County
Web Producer: Taylor Higgins
WILLCOX, Ariz. (AP) - Authorities say a man fatally shot his father and then turned the gun on himself in a murder-suicide in southern Arizona.
The Cochise County Sheriff's Office says the 36-year-old man came to his father's home about 15 miles south of Willcox around midday Saturday to pick up belongings and shot his 62-year-old father several times as he sat at a desk.
The 36-year-old man's stepmother fled from the home, called authorities and wasn't injured in the shooting.
Authorities say they the son was later located inside the home with an apparent self-inflicted gunshot wound.
The names of the men who died in the shooting haven't yet been released.
